Purpose Bitcoin ETF (TSE:BTCC.B – Get Free Report)’s stock price traded down 1% during mid-day trading on Wednesday . The company traded as low as C$12.83 and last traded at C$12.88. 74,836 shares changed hands during mid-day trading, a decline of 76% from the average daily volume of 307,920 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$13.01.
Purpose Bitcoin ETF Trading Down 1.0%
The stock has a fifty day moving average price of C$12.96 and a 200-day moving average price of C$14.02.
Purpose Bitcoin ETF Company Profile
Purpose Bitcoin ETF (the Fund) seeks to buy and hold substantially all of its assets in the digital currency Bitcoin and seeks to provide unitholders of ETF units with the opportunity for long-term capital appreciation. To achieve its investment objective, the Fund invests in and holds substantially all of its assets in Bitcoin in order to provide unitholders with a secure, convenient, lower-cost alternative to a direct investment in Bitcoin.
